There are several types of key cutting machines that can be used to design new keys or duplicates of existing keys. They are accurate as well as safe and efficient. They can produce keys that are completed in only minutes. In addition, these machines can be used to cut skeleton keys to houses mailboxes, apartments and houses.

Certain key cutting machines have been designed to cut specific types of keys, including automobile tubular keys, automotive dimple keys, or an automobile edge-cut key. Other key cutting machines are designed to cut a broad range of keys, such as double-bit and bit keys. Some machines can even cut keys like a Jaguar or Ford Tibbe Key. The Image SK1 can be used as an example of key cutting equipment of high quality that can cut all these kinds of keys.

If you're in the market for a new key duplicator, it's important to look for one that has 2-way jaws that are able to handle the most used keys. You should also think about purchasing a key cutting adapter which is a tiny piece of steel that's designed to lie flat on the keys while duplicating. This makes it easier for the key to be cut precisely. These adapters are compatible with many different keyways that include keys from GM B106 and, TR47 Toyota keys, and SFIC and Kwikset keys.

The Immobilizer chip is found in an Audi Key

Modern Audi vehicles utilize transponder chips in place of traditional keys which depend on mechanical turning to open doors and start engines. As such, a new key must be properly programmed to be compatible with the car's immobilizer system. This is a job best left to an experienced auto locksmith as it requires specialized tools and a deep knowledge of Audi's security systems.
